(TOWNSHIP OF CHATSWORTH, ON) – On April 21, 2016, at approximately 9:09 a.m., Grey County Ontario Provincial Police (OPP) received a report of a break and enter to an apartment on McNab Street in the Township of Chatsworth.
Shortly before 9:00 a.m. on April 21st, the victim was out for a walk. When he returned to his apartment at short time later, he discovered that someone had entered the unlocked apartment and removed a quantity of prescription medication.
Grey County OPP continue to investigate and ask anyone with information regarding this incident to call the OPP at 1-888-310-1122.
